The answering mode which is best for you will vary depending on how
you use your machine and what external telephone devices are connected
to it. See the ‘Answering Mode Options’ section in the User’s Guide on the
CD to select the mode you require.
To change the Answering Mode:
1
Press the AUTO REC key. Your machine displays your current
answering mode.
2
Continue pressing the AUTO REC key until the answering mode you
want appears on the display. After a short pause, your machine
programs the new answering mode and returns to stand-by mode
displaying the new answering mode setting.
Setting Machine Identification
The machine uses the information you enter here to identify itself during
communications. In most countries programming this information into
your machine is a legal requirement.
1
Press the SELECT FUNCTION key then the USER PROG One
Touch key followed by 4 on the numeric keypad. The display shows:

2
Press the YES key. The display shows:
NO=
ID=
3
After the display clears, enter the full telephone number of your fax
machine using the numeric keypad up to twenty characters. Use the
HYPHEN or 8/+ One Touch key to enter a “+” character before the
number to indicate the international access code before the country
dialling code. The 9/SPACE One Touch key is used to enter spaces in
a number.
4
Press the START key to save your entry.
5
Enter your Sender ID. This is a descriptive title up to 32 characters long.
See the ‘Setting Machine Identification’ section in the User’s Guide on
the CD for instructions on entering special characters.
6
Press the START key to save your entry. The display shows:
